The Raven

Words from the poem The Raven by Edgar Allan Poe.

Full list of words from this list:

  1. apt
    being of striking appropriateness and relevance
  2. beguile
    attract; cause to be enamored
  3. censer
    a container for burning incense
  4. decorum
    propriety in manners and conduct
  5. dirge
    a song or hymn of mourning as a memorial to a dead person
  6. discourse
    an extended communication dealing with some particular topic
  7. dreary
    lacking in liveliness or charm or surprise
  8. ember
    a hot, smoldering fragment of wood left from a fire
  9. entreat
    ask for or request earnestly
  10. gaunt
    very thin, especially from disease or hunger or cold
  11. implore
    beg or request earnestly and urgently
  12. lore
    knowledge gained through tradition or anecdote
  13. mere
    being nothing more than specified
  14. mien
    a person's appearance, manner, or demeanor
  15. morrow
    the next day
  16. Nepenthes
    pitcher plants
  17. obeisance
    bending the head or body in reverence or submission
  18. ominous
    threatening or foreshadowing evil or tragic developments
  19. peer
    look searchingly
  20. placid
    calm and free from disturbance
  21. plume
    the feather of a bird
  22. ponder
    reflect deeply on a subject
  23. quaff
    swallow hurriedly or greedily or in one draught
  24. quaint
    attractively old-fashioned
  25. relevancy
    the relation of something to the matter at hand
  26. seraph
    an angel of the first order
  27. surcease
    a stopping
  28. tufted
    having or adorned with tufts
  29. weary
    physically and mentally fatigued
  30. wrought
    shaped to fit by altering the contours of a pliable mass
  31. countenance
    the appearance conveyed by a person's face
  32. bleak
    unpleasantly cold and damp
  33. yore
    time long past
  34. craven
    lacking even the rudiments of courage; abjectly fearful
